Step 2: Establishment of Environmental Control Systems
Once familiar with the legal framework, organizations need to develop and implement robust environmental control systems. These systems should encompass air quality control, personnel hygiene, water and waste management, and temperature and humidity monitoring. The goal is to minimize contamination risks that could jeopardize product quality.
The environmental monitoring program should include the following core components:
- Air Quality Control: Ensure that the air supply systems are effectively filtered and validated to meet the required particulate and microbiological limits.
- Temperature and Humidity Monitoring: Continuous monitoring systems should be in place to maintain appropriate temperature and humidity levels in critical manufacturing areas. Additionally, a deviation management plan must be developed for instances where environmental parameters exceed acceptable limits.
- Water and Waste Management: Develop protocols to monitor water quality and management practices to ensure compliance with safety guidelines. Waste disposal practices must align with local regulations, ensuring proper segregation and disposal of hazardous materials.
Documenting the design and implementation of these systems in a comprehensive Environmental Control Plan (ECP) facilitates inspections by providing evidence of compliance with regulatory expectations. Regular training sessions for personnel involved in environmental controls ensure that they are competent in executing these procedures effectively.
Step 3: Risk Assessment and Management
Risk assessment is a crucial component that integrates into the environmental compliance framework in pharmaceutical regulatory affairs. Organizations are expected to conduct detailed evaluations of potential risks posed by environmental factors to product quality, using formal methodologies such as Failure Mode and Effects Analysis (FMEA).
Key stages in the risk assessment process include:
- Identification of Hazards: Systematically identify and categorize risks associated with environmental factors that can affect product integrity.
- Assessment of Risks: Determine the severity and likelihood of identified risks through qualitative and quantitative analysis.
- Control Measures: Implement strategies to mitigate identified risks. This may include changes in operating procedures, the introduction of automated monitoring systems, or ensuring redundancy in critical systems.
It is imperative to document the entire risk management process adequately, detailing decisions made, risk methodologies employed, and validation of control measures. These records enable inspections to validate that the organization is not only aware of potential risks but is actively managing them in compliance with regulatory expectations.

Step 6: Regulatory Inspection Preparation
Regulatory inspections are often the culmination of compliance efforts and serve as a critical opportunity to validate adherence to environmental controls. Preparing for these inspections requires strategic planning and organization.
Key elements to consider include:
- Internal Audits: Conduct thorough internal audits focused on environmental compliance to identify potential gaps ahead of the inspection. Evaluate the preparedness of environmental control systems, documentation, and compliance with established protocols.
- Mock Inspections: Organize mock inspections to help staff practice responding to questions from inspectors. These scenarios can enhance familiarity and build confidence during actual inspections.
- Preparation of Inspection Documentation: Assemble key documents, including SOPs, risk assessments, environmental monitoring reports, and the Environmental Control Plan, categorized for easy access during the inspection.
By creating an environment of compliance through readiness and organization, organizations can not only effectively navigate inspections but also demonstrate a culture of quality that prioritizes environmental controls and adheres to pharmaceutical regulatory affairs standards.
Step 7: Post-Approval Commitments and Continuous Improvement
Post-approval commitments form a vital part of maintaining compliance with regulatory expectations in environmental controls. Following approval, organizations must continue to monitor and enhance their environmental compliance frameworks to mitigate risks that could impact product quality.
Key actions include:
- Continuous Monitoring: Implement a continual environmental monitoring program that validates compliance with regulatory requirements on an ongoing basis. This can include routine sampling and analysis of air and water quality, as well as regular reviews of monitoring equipment calibration.
- Feedback Mechanisms: Establish internal mechanisms for reporting deviations and implementing corrective actions. Utilize findings from inspections, both internal and external, to inform improvements in environmental compliance.
- Engagement with Regulatory Updates: Stay abreast of changes in environmental regulations and guidelines from regulatory authorities and ensure that adjustments are adequately reflected in organizational practices.
By fostering a culture of compliance and proactive engagement with regulatory expectations, organizations can not only ensure ongoing adherence to environmental controls but also contribute to the overarching goals of quality assurance within pharmaceutical regulatory affairs.
